THE world’s tallest and fastest rollercoaster is now in Spain – and has a whopping top speed of 112mph. The Red Force rollercoaster at the Ferrari Land amusement park near Barcelona ...
Formula Rossa celebrates speed, aerodynamics and technical innovation. A featured attraction at Ferrari World Abu Dhabi, the world's first Ferrari theme park and largest attraction of its kind ...